How to sync PKO Bank Polski Corporate to Home Assistant


map your columns once
Search for PKO Bank Polski Corporate in BankSync
Sign up for BankSync and, if PKO Bank Polski Corporate is available, link your account through a provider-hosted or bank-hosted authorization flow. BankSync does not store your online banking credentials.
Authorize Home Assistant
Authorise BankSync to write data to your Home Assistant workspace. Select the database, table, or sheet where the supported account data should land.
Configure field mappings
Map the supported PKO Bank Polski Corporate fields supplied by the provider to columns in Home Assistant.
Set your sync schedule
Choose hourly, daily, or weekly automatic syncs based on your plan, or run a manual sync at any time.
